Opportunities in the Fisheries Sector

Economics +1 more

GAMBIA - Easy entry, which requires no capital to start operating and no formal qualifications and the fisheries sector, provides opportunities for many poor and vulnerable people.

Fish processing and trading at the artisan level provides diversified employment opportunities in fishing communities, reports All Africa. Although little is understood about poverty in the post-harvest sector, there is a wide diversity of academic and civil society skills that understand wider poverty issues and this could be applied to the sector to increase understanding of post-harvest poverty in the country.

In addition, the Gambia poverty reduction strategy provides a valuable framework for addressing poverty that could be directly applied to poverty in the post-harvest sector and to guide support for poverty reduction approaches.

The diversity and experience of representative bodies in fisheries can generally provide a template for better representation of stakeholders in the post-harvest sector in the future. Meanwhile, the existing networking and linkages between the women in the sector could be improved upon to create a more formal institution for their representation and a source for collateral to secure formal bank loans for their operations.
